To have the fastest healing time and achieve the best cosmetic result, your Mohs wound likely will require stitches. You will return to your doctor in approximately 7-14 days to have your stitches removed. Occasionally, dissolvable stitches are used. If you have stitches, keep the area dry for the first 24-48 hours following surgery.

Web6 dec. 2024 · Bracing your wound can help to prevent your incision from opening after surgery. Plan to brace your wound when coughing, sneezing, rising from a seated … WebAvoid activities that cause heavy sweating. Protect the incision or wound from sunlight. Do not scratch, rub, or pick at the glue. Do not put tape directly over the glue. The glue should peel off within 5 to 10 days. Surgical tape. Keep your incision or wound dry. If it gets wet, blot the area dry with a clean towel.
